Key Responsibilities
Injury Prevention & Care: Provide standard first aid, evaluation, and immediate treatment of acute athletic injuries during practices and home/away scheduled games.
Rehabilitation: Develop and implement comprehensive rehabilitation and reconditioning programs for injured student-athletes.
Game & Practice Coverage: Coordinate and provide healthcare coverage for all assigned athletic practices, home contests, and designated away events.
Communication & Collaboration: Act as the primary liaison between student-athletes, parents, coaching staffs, school administration, and team physicians regarding injury status and return-to-play protocols.
Administrative Duties: Maintain meticulous electronic medical records of all injuries, treatments, and clearances in compliance with HIPAA and FERPA regulations.
Emergency Management: Maintain and execute the school’s Athletic Emergency Action Plan (EAP). Ensure all medical equipment (AEDs, splints, first aid kits) is stocked and operational.
Job Requirements
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Athletic Training from an CAATE-accredited program.
Board of Certification (BOC) certified for Athletic Trainers.
Current MA State Licensure (or eligible to obtain before start date).
Current CPR/AED for the Professional Rescuer or BLS certification.
Experience working in a high school or collegiate athletic setting is preferred, but passionate new graduates are welcome to apply!
Strong clinical diagnostic skills, exceptional communication, ability to remain calm under pressure, and a flexible schedule to accommodate afternoon, evening, and occasional weekend athletic events.
